.footer{background-color:var(--c-primary-light);padding:var(--sp-large) 0 .25rem}.footer__title{color:var(--c-primary);font-family:var(--f-basic);font-size:1.25rem;font-weight:500;font-weight:700;letter-spacing:.15rem;line-height:1.25;margin:0 0 .25em;margin:0 0 var(--sp-small);text-align:center;text-transform:uppercase;word-break:keep-all}.footer__title:first-child{margin-top:0}@media (min-width:992px){.footer__title{font-size:1.5rem}}.footer__title a,.footer__title h1,.footer__title h2,.footer__title h3,.footer__title h4,.footer__title h5,.footer__title h6,.footer__title p{color:inherit;font-family:inherit;font-size:inherit;font-weight:inherit;line-height:inherit}.footer__title h1,.footer__title h2,.footer__title h3,.footer__title h4,.footer__title h5,.footer__title h6,.footer__title p{margin:0;padding:0}.footer__text{line-height:2;margin-bottom:var(--sp-medium);text-align:center}@media (max-width:767.98px){.footer__text{font-size:.75rem}}.footer__text a,.footer__text h1,.footer__text h2,.footer__text h3,.footer__text h4,.footer__text h5,.footer__text h6,.footer__text p{color:inherit;font-family:inherit;font-size:inherit;font-weight:inherit;line-height:inherit}.footer__bisdom{display:flex;justify-content:center;margin:var(--sp-small)}.footer__bisdom img{height:auto;max-width:18rem;width:100%}.footer__credits{font-size:.75rem}.footer__credits a{color:currentColor}.footer__credits a:hover{opacity:.7}.footer__signin{text-align:right}.footer__login,.footer__logout{color:currentColor;font-size:.75rem;text-align:right}
